Output 382667a34bd4b5303af7c47fb2ac78d3326c6550a24fc00827ccdcb265f8e561:0

value
13628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c8369b981b8485569df1279128548cc233de9b3 OP_EQUALVERIFY OP_CHECKSIG
address
1CMNDXEtpu1s15WRZUd5CUNSXNbstfAHUm
transaction
382667a34bd4b5303af7c47fb2ac78d3326c6550a24fc00827ccdcb265f8e561
spent
true